gunzip

English

Etymology

From the name of the software program, originally short for GNU unzip.

Verb

gunzip (third-person singular simple present gunzips, present participle gunzipping, simple past and past participle gunzipped)

  1. (transitive, computing) To decompress using the gzip program.
